FIFA Threatens Clubs


The Issue of race has been a big issue in the World's Game in Recent years. While fans threw peanuts and taunted African players, what has FIFA done to change the behavior of fans? FIFA states that they want to start fining clubs, deducting points from clubs, suspend and/or exclude clubs and Players if fans acts or even some players acts continue. These racist acts are not new and have been happening for awhile, where was FIFA when Marco Zoro, Samuel Eto'o, or Thierry Henry were victims of these acts? They state that they have been aware of the issue for awhile but only recently has it been a big issue of interest.
